About the Book

We see it every day, yet we understand so little about Earth. From minerals to meteorites, this book covers every aspect of the science of our world. It breaks this complex discipline into four major sections: geology, oceanography, meteorology, and planetary science, and it gives an overview of the processes of each. Complete with interactive experiments and a glossary, this book makes the study of our planet—and other planets— easier than ever.

About the Author

Edward F. Albin, Ph.D.
EDWARD F. ALBIN, Ph.D., is an assistant professor of geology and astronomy at Agnes Scott College in Decatur, GA. His work at the Fernbank Science Center includes instruction in all areas of Earth science. More by Edward F. Albin, Ph.D.
